    [font=Arial, Helvetica, sans-serif]Thunder storm in February blow my eircom modem out of wall socket and damaged the line outside.[/font]
    [font=Arial, Helvetica, sans-serif]After 3 weeks of technicians calling with no results I cancelled my broadband.[/font]
    [font=Arial, Helvetica, sans-serif]Today I got a bill for 120 euro for two modems.[/font]
    [font=Arial, Helvetica, sans-serif]I believe I should have returned the modem when contract was cancelled but no idea where the second modem has come out of.[/font]
    [font=Arial, Helvetica, sans-serif]Any advice[/font]

    Hi Hedgecutter,

    Thanks for getting in touch :) 

    When closing an account you would be required to return the modem to us within fourteen days of the date you provide us with written notice that you wish to cancel the contract, this would be outlined in the terms and conditions here https://www.eir.ie/opencms/export/sites/default/.content/pdf/pricing/eir_General_Terms_and_Conditions.pdf. These charges would be automatically generated on your account however due to the circumstances you should not be charged for the modem.  
    Please feel free to PM me your account number and I will arrange to remove this charge.
